About Teck Resources Stock (NYSE:TECK)

Teck Resources Limited engages in exploring for, acquiring, developing, and producing natural resources in Asia, Europe, and North America. The company operates through Steelmaking Coal, Copper, Zinc, and Energy segments. Its principal products include copper, zinc, steelmaking coal, and blended bitumen. The company also produces lead, silver, and molybdenum; and various specialty and other metals, chemicals, and fertilizers. In addition, it explores for gold. The company was formerly known as Teck Cominco Limited and changed its name to Teck Resources Limited in April 2009. The company was founded in 1913 and is headquartered in Vancouver, Canada.

How were Teck Resources' earnings last quarter?

Teck Resources Limited (NYSE:TECK) iss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February, 22nd. The basic materials company reported $1.02 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.01 by $0.01. The basic materials company had revenue of $3.02 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$3.11 billion. Teck Resources had a net margin of 16.21% and a trailing twelve-month return on equity of 9.67%.

How often does Teck Resources pay dividends? What is the dividend yield for Teck Resources?

Teck Resources declared a quarterly dividend on Friday, February 23rd. Shareholders of record on Friday, March 15th will be paid a dividend of $0.0925 per share on Thursday, March 28th. This represents a $0.37 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.75%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, March 14th.
